Cedaredge vs Montrose

PLACE A
Cedaredge, Colorado
VS
PLACE B
Montrose, Pennsylvania
Cedaredge is 92% larger than Montrose. Montrose earns more, with a median household income $5,655 higher. Cedaredge has grown faster since 2000 (1% vs -20%).
